I am a NY State Licensed and National Board Certified Massage Therapist. Honestly speaking, deep tissue massage is in great demand as people stress out from work and life. About 90% of my clients come for deep tissue massage.
I have most of the reference material for Deep Tissue Massage, including this book and DVD by Art Riggs, Deep Tissue & Neuromuscular Therapy (2 sets) by Sean Riehl, Balanced Body by Donald W. Scheumann, and Myoskeletal Alignment Techniques (Vol 1) by Erik Dalton. Art Riggs' teaching material excels from them all. Furthermore, I appreciated the way how Riggs handled customer complaints. Riggs answered my email complaints personally and have turned a customer complaint into a praise. On the other extreme, I never got any email answer from Erik Dalton regarding my purchase (I did get an order confirmation from his company).
A final word, you will not regret buying the study material from Art Riggs, and don't waste money on the studying material for Myoskeletal Alignment Techniques. Most of the techniques from Myoskeletal Alignment (Vol 1) can be found in Art Riggs' Deep Tissue Massage.

(North Atlantic Books) Textbook-style manual for massage therapists who have completed or are in the process of completing basic massage training. Includes many photographs and illustrations for reference, biomechanics for preventing injury, and directions for treatment and rehabilitation for common complaints. Quick-reference guide to techniques. DNLM: Massage--methods--Atlases.
